"remove all of the memory cards and press select"

I plugged in my printer, lexmark x6570, to scan something and the screen reads: "remove ALL of the memory cards and press select". I have never used a memory card or photo card to my knowledge. I only scanned about 5 pictures on this printer in the past. Only the photo card button will light up, I can't press the copy mode, scan mode or fax mode. Thank you for your help.

  • Anonymous May 11, 2010

    Have you tried rebricking the printer to refresh itself? Unplug the power supply(black box behind the printer where the power cord is attached) from the printer. Wait for at least a minute then plug it back in. Make there's no memory card inserted in the printer.

I am having problems connecting to a lexmark X6570 printer using wifi on my laptop, I have windows 7 64 bits

You may need to reset the printer's wireless network adapter first before re-installing the printer driver. Here's How to Reset the Network Settings on the X6570 Series AIO Inkjet Printer.
Also, the printer driver cjb6500en is for 32-bit operating systems. Please visit the Lexmark website at http://bit.ly/Iwhh8m to download and install the correct printer driver for a Windows 7 64-bit ( cjq6500en.exe ). Simply follow the instructions on your computer screen to complete the installation.

HP C5180 All-in-one : Memory Card Error, No memory card in it

  1. Remove the memory card from the camera.
  2. Locate the memory card slot on the product that is compatible with your memory card. Figure 1: Memory card slot locations c01331721.jpg 1 - CompactFlash (I, II) 2 - Secure Digital, MultiMediaCard (MMC), Secure MultiMedia Card 3 - xD-Picture Card 4 - Memory Stick, Magic Gate Memory Stick, Memory Stick Duo (with user-supplied adapter), Memory Stick Pro 5 - Front universal serial bus (USB) port (PictBridge-enabled)
    NOTE: Some portable USB flash drives with a read-only partition, such as U3 smart drives, might be incompatible with the front mass storage port on your product. These partitions are added by the manufacturer and may include utilities and other software. Refer to the manufacturer for additional details about your drive.
  3. If it is not already on, turn the product on by pressing the power button (c01324469.gif ).
  4. Turn the memory card so that the label faces inward and the contacts face the product. Figure 2: Inserting the memory card c01335108.gif CAUTION: Inserting the memory card in any other way might damage the card and the product.
  5. Gently push the memory card into the memory card slot until it stops. The memory card does not insert all the way into the product; do not try to force it.
  6. When the memory card is inserted correctly, the status light next to the memory card slots flashes and then remains solid green. CAUTION: Never attempt to remove a memory card while it is being accessed. Doing so can damage files on the card. You can safely remove a card only when the status light next to the memory card slots is not blinking. Do not pull out a memory card while the light is flashing green.
Step two: Print the photo
  1. Press Photo Menu . A message displays on the control panel with the number of files found on the memory card.
  2. Press the right (c01185072.jpg ) and left (c01185108.jpg ) arrow buttons to browse through the photos on the memory card.
  3. When the photo number you want to print appears, press OK .
  4. After selecting the photos, press Photo Menu again.
  5. Press the right arrow button (c01185072.jpg ) to select Number of Copies , and then press OK .
  6. Press the right arrow button (c01185072.jpg ) to select Layout , and then press OK .
  7. Press the right arrow button (c01185072.jpg ) to select Paper Size , and then press OK .
  8. Press the right arrow button (c01185072.jpg ) to select Paper Type , and then press OK .
  9. Make any other appropriate changes to the settings, and then press Print Photos .
